BillOatman 596 Posted April 30, 2019 Posted April 30, 2019 Hi. I watched a movie tonight and at the end, the watched checkbox was selected which I expected. But then back at the movie list screen, that movie was no longer displayed. I looked all over, but how do I get Emby to show me watched content? Thanks.
Happy2Play 9787 Posted April 30, 2019 Posted April 30, 2019 What location are you referring to? Are you referring to Home Screen? User preferences (user icon) - Home Screen Hide watched content from latest media
BillOatman 596 Posted April 30, 2019 Author Posted April 30, 2019 Thanks but no. I have a library named documentaries. That library view had the video displayed, I watched it, then it was no longer displayed. I imagine there is a setting similar to the one you suggested but for all libraries or individual libraries, but I couldn't find it.
Happy2Play 9787 Posted April 30, 2019 Posted April 30, 2019 The only way content is not displayed in a library is if you have filters applied. If it is not filters, then you will need to show a screenshot of exactly where you are talking about.
BillOatman 596 Posted April 30, 2019 Author Posted April 30, 2019 Found it finally. The shield UI has a tiny icon in the upper right that is a circle with a line through it with a checkmark inside. When activated it hides all videos that have been watched (has a check mark). Somehow it got set. Thanks.
